You'll need 12 to 24 months of personal or business bank statements. Lenders calculate your income from deposits, not your Schedule C.
Bank statement loans are non-QM products. That means they don't follow Fannie Mae or Freddie Mac rules. Only select wholesale lenders offer them.
Rates run higher than conventional loans. That's the tradeoff for skipping income documentation. Rates vary by borrower profile and market conditions.
The biggest mistake I see: borrowers applying with only one account when their income flows through three. Lenders want the full deposit picture.
Business owners using a business account should expect a lender to apply an expense ratio — usually 50% — to gross deposits. Run those numbers before you apply.
If your income is primarily 1099-based, a 1099 loan might qualify you at a better rate. P&L loans work if your accountant can produce a certified profit and loss.
DSCR loans skip income verification entirely — but they're for investment properties only. Bank statement loans cover primary residences, second homes, and rentals.
Bishop's economy runs on tourism, outdoor recreation, and agriculture. Guides, outfitters, shop owners, and ranchers often have strong cash flow but complex tax returns.
Inyo County is rural. Some lenders apply overlays — stricter rules — for rural properties. Working with a broker who shops across 200+ lenders matters more here.
